Title: The Importance of Location Services in Mobile Apps

Introduction

Mobile applications have become an integral part of our daily lives, providing us with convenience, entertainment, and access to a plethora of services. However, when users encounter the frustrating message “no location found” while trying to use a specific app, it can be a significant setback. In this article, we will delve into the importance of location services in mobile apps and how they enhance user experiences.

1. Understanding Location Services

Location services are features embedded within mobile applications that utilize GPS, Wi-Fi, cellular network data, or a combination of these technologies to determine and track a user’s geographical location. These services enable apps to provide personalized and location-specific content, features, and recommendations.

2. Personalized Experiences

Location services allow mobile apps to tailor content and services based on a user’s location. For instance, a food delivery app can display nearby restaurants or offer exclusive deals based on the user’s current position. This personalization enhances user experiences by providing relevant and timely information.

3. Navigation and Mapping

One of the most common uses of location services is in navigation and mapping apps. Whether it’s finding the fastest route to a destination, locating nearby points of interest, or tracking real-time traffic conditions, these apps heavily rely on accurate and up-to-date location data. Without location services, these apps would lose their primary function and become ineffective.

4. Geolocation-based Social Networking

Location services enable social networking apps to connect users based on their proximity. This feature allows individuals to discover and connect with like-minded people nearby, fostering new friendships, professional networking, and even romantic relationships. Without accurate location data, these connections would be impossible to establish.

5. E-commerce and Local Business Promotions

Location-based apps play a vital role in e-commerce and local business promotions. By using location services, apps can suggest nearby stores, restaurants, or service providers to users, leading to increased foot traffic and sales for local businesses. Additionally, these apps can provide personalized promotions or discounts based on the user’s current location, boosting customer engagement and loyalty.

6. Safety and Emergency Services

Location services are crucial in emergency situations, as they enable users to quickly share their whereabouts with emergency responders. Whether it’s contacting emergency services, reporting accidents, or locating missing persons, these features heavily rely on accurate and reliable location data. Without them, response times could be delayed, potentially endangering lives.

7. Fitness and Health Tracking

Fitness and health tracking apps heavily rely on location services to accurately track and record physical activities such as running, cycling, or hiking. By utilizing GPS data, these apps can provide users with accurate distance, speed, and elevation information. Furthermore, location services can also assist in providing personalized fitness recommendations based on the user’s location and nearby fitness facilities.

8. Travel and Tourism

Location services are essential for travel and tourism apps, helping users discover nearby attractions, landmarks, restaurants, and accommodations. These apps can also provide real-time information on local events, weather conditions, and transportation options, enhancing the overall travel experience.

9. Weather Forecasting

Weather apps rely on precise location data to provide accurate and localized forecasts. By using location services, these apps can deliver hyper-local weather information, including temperature, humidity, wind speed, and precipitation, tailored to the user’s current location.

10. Location-based Gaming

The rise of location-based gaming, such as augmented reality (AR) games, has further highlighted the importance of location services. These games utilize real-world locations as the playing field, encouraging users to explore their surroundings while interacting with virtual elements. Without accurate location data, these games would lose their immersive and interactive nature.

Conclusion

Location services play a pivotal role in enhancing the functionality and user experience of mobile apps. From personalized recommendations to navigation, social networking, e-commerce, emergency services, and more, accurate location data is crucial. As technology continues to advance, location services will become even more integral, enabling apps to provide users with relevant and context-aware content, services, and experiences.
